"The Brothers Solomon"
This film was made by director Bob Odenkirk and writer/ leading man Will Forte in 2007. With the notable actors of Will Arnett and Charles Chun.
IMDB gave it a 5.1 out of 10.

This movie is about two brothers who are socially inept trying to find mates so that their dying father can see his grandchild before he dies. That's pretty much it.

I liked this movie, it was funny, awkward and a good time all rolled into one. However the comedy in it was not the wittiest. And the awkward scenes are very very awkward (on purpose). There isn't much I can say about this movie...
I give this movie a 7 out of 10 it was fun in the childish sense but it's not for everyone.
